Safety

  • Wear safety glasses to protect against potential glass shards while prying the screen.
  • Disconnect the battery power source before touching internal electronics or flex cables.
  • Keep heat tools below 80°C (175°F) to prevent damage to the display panel.

Step-by-step

  1. 1

    Power Down Device

    1 min

    Turn off the iPad Air 5 completely and unplug any connected cables before beginning.

  2. 2

    Heat Front Glass Edges

    3 min

    Apply a heated iOpener or heat gun around the edges of the display for two minutes to soften the adhesive.

  3. 3

    Attach Suction Cup

    2 min

    Place a suction cup near the bottom edge of the display glass and pull upward gently to create a gap.

  4. 4

    Insert Opening Pick

    2 min

    Insert an opening pick into the seam under the display glass as soon as a gap appears.

  5. 5

    Slice Right Edge Adhesive

    3 min

    Slide the pick along the right edge of the iPad, keeping it shallower than 3mm to avoid damaging internal cables.

  6. 6

    Slice Top and Left Adhesive

    4 min

    Continue slicing through the adhesive along the top and left edges while re-heating if the adhesive cools.

  7. 7

    Open Display Assembly

    2 min

    Carefully lift the display assembly from the right edge, opening it slowly like the cover of a book.

  8. 8

    Unscrew Connector Shield

    2 min

    Remove the four Phillips screws securing the metal shield over the display and battery connectors.

  9. 9

    Remove Shield Plate

    1 min

    Use tweezers to lift the metal connector shield off the logic board and set it aside.

  10. 10

    Disconnect Battery Connection

    2 min

    Slide a plastic battery blocker pick beneath the battery contact terminal to cut power to the logic board.

  11. 11

    Disconnect Display Cables

    2 min

    Use a spudger to gently pop the display and digitizer flex cable connectors off the logic board.

  12. 12

    Remove Display Assembly

    1 min

    Lift the display assembly free from the frame and place it in a safe, clean location.

  13. 13

    Unscrew Button Bracket

    2 min

    Remove the two Phillips screws securing the metal bracket over the top button assembly.

  14. 14

    Remove Metal Bracket

    1 min

    Use tweezers to lift the metal button retaining bracket off the top frame.

  15. 15

    Pry Up Button Flex Cable

    2 min

    Gently slide a flat spudger under the flex cable to separate its adhesive from the aluminum case.

  16. 16

    Remove Top Button

    2 min

    Push the top power/Touch ID button inward from the outside frame and remove the entire button assembly.

  17. 17

    Install Replacement Button

    3 min

    Fit the new button assembly into the top frame cutout and lay its flex cable flat against the case.

  18. 18

    Reinstall Metal Bracket

    2 min

    Position the metal retaining bracket over the button assembly and tighten the two Phillips screws.

After your Apple iPad Air 5 home button repair

Power the iPad Air 5 back on and test the home button repair function before you put every screw away. Check touch/display response, charging, cameras, buttons, and wireless as relevant to this repair. If something fails after closing the device, reopen carefully and reseat the connectors for this Apple iPad Air 5 job before assuming the part is defective. Keep leftover adhesive and screws labeled in case you need a second pass.
